Yet Washington was a male of advancement, that rarely allowed a possibility slip byand when he worked with a Scottish plantation supervisor in 1797, Washington added one more line to his return to: scotch seller. The planation supervisor, James Anderson, had actually arrived to Virginia in the very early 1790snoticed a missed possibility at the estate: the abundance of plants, incorporated with Washington's state-of-the-art gristmill and bountiful supply of water could be utilized to make whiskey.

Washington, to assist foster healthy and balanced dirt, grew a great deal of rye as a cover crop. Rye had not been high up on the list of tasty, edible grains, yet Anderson really did not believe it needs to most likely to wasteinstead, he intended to transform it into bourbon. Washington was, at initially, hesitant to jump into a new organization ventureafter all, at 65 years old, he had actually wanted to invest his retired years in loved one tranquility, but after listening to Anderson's proposal, as well as matching with a buddy who was entailed in the rum business, Washington gave in




When Washington died in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, who did not have the intelligent business mind of Washington. Lewis wasn't virtually as effective in the distilling business, and when a fire melted the distillery to the ground in 1814, it wasn't rebuilt. The state of Virginia purchased the site in the early 1930s, and intended to rebuild the distillery, however only took care of to rebuild the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ly because the stress of Restriction and the Clinical Check Out Your URL depression didn't urge the rebuilding of the distillery.


By 2007, the distillery was open to the general public. The rebuilt distillery is even more than a fixed tribute to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its very own. Annually, Steve Bashore, manager of historical trades at Mount Vernon, leads a tiny group in distilling whiskey exactly as Anderson and others carried out in the initial distillery.

The grains are ground in the gristmill, then contributed to barrels in the distillery along with 110 gallons of boiling water




On the third day of the process, yeast is added, which eats the sugars and transforms them into alcohol. After that, the mash is put right into the copper stills (which we recreated from an enduring 18th-century still displayed in the distillery's gallery, on the structure's second floor), where it is heated up by a timber fire.


As the alcohol vapor cools down, it condenses back to liquid, which spurts of the barrel into a container. To see just how bourbon is made at Mount Vernon, take a look at the video below. In Washington's day, this whiskey would certainly be marketed clear and unagedbut today (due to the fact that there's a market for it), Bashore and Mount Vernon will certainly mature several of the bourbon that they distill.
